Ok, Ghent (as I see I should be spelling it in English) is a fun student city with a medieval past. There are lots of great botiques and cafes. The night life, due to all the students, is happening. There are breathtaking cathedrals, castles and charming midieval streets to walk down. Both the Contemporary and Fine Arts museums are worth visiting (though you have some great museums in Brussels.)

Gardens:

In Ghent you have the Hortus Mischel Thiery. This is a historical garden that borders on the museum of natural history. It is open from 9:00 - 17:15

Address:
Berouw 55
B 9000 GEnt

Just outside of Ghent, in the village Evergem, is a privat garden that looks like it is worth visiting. It is the home the family Smet and is a formal garden designed by Erik De Waele. Flowing taxus hedges lead you to a evergreen garden. Via the trope-l'oleil you reach the backyard with a borders, a rose garden and a pond.

Address:
Eelkostraat 71
B 9940 Evergrem

Telephone #:
+32 (0)93 449714

Also outside of Ghent is the Garden of Albert De Raedt in Gavere. This is a English landcape garden with a large natural pond. There are 400 sorts of rhododendrons and azaelas as well as numerous other shrubs and trees.

Address:
Gentsebaan 76
B 9890 Gavere

Telephone#:
+32 (0)93 843557
